Chhapar is a small village in Jhajjar district in the state Haryana of India. It is situated 32 km away from Jhajjar, which is both District & Sub District headquarter of Chhapar village. It is 88 km from New Delhi and situated 7.4 km away from National Highway 71 on the road from Kulana to Kosli. Chhapar village is also a gram panchayat. The total geographical area of village is 732 hectares. Chhapar has a total population of 2,878 peoples.There are about 567 houses in Chhapar village. There is a temple of Shri Baba Ganga Das in Chhapar, all the residents of Chhapar, Sarola, Jaitpur, Babepur and Ushmaapur are devotees of Shri Baba Ganga Das.

Jhajjar is nearest town to Chhapar. Chhapar is located at latitude 28.4433134 and longitude 76.5986667. Chandigarh is the state capital for Chhapar village and about 309 km away from Chhapar. The adjoining villages of Chhapar are Sarola, Ushmaapur, Nyola, Kanhori, Khudan, Jaitpur, Ahri, Subana and Babepur.

The native language of Chhapar is Haryanvi and most of the village people speak Haryanvi. People of Chhapar use Hindi & English languages for their official communications.

Chhapar is well connected by road with all parts of the nation. National Highway 71 is just 7.4 km away from Chhapar. The nearest railway station to Chhapar is Machhrauli which lies on Rewari-Rohtak line. Rewari Junction is the nearest major railway junction which is about 40 km away. The nearest Airport is Indira Gandhi International Airport, New Delhi at a distance of 77 km.

There are 3 schools functional in the village, Govt Senior Secondary School Chhapar, S D Senior Secondary School Chhapar and Gurukul Public School Chhapar. Jhajjar, Rohtak and Delhi are the nearby options for further education.

Naveen Kumar of Chhapar is an international athlete who represented India several times in various International Athletics Championships. He won bronze medal at the Asian Games 2014, Incheon in 3000M Steeplechase by performing his personal best 08:40.39 sec. Wrestling and Cricket are also popular games in Chhapar and there are many National level wrestlers in the village.
